Output de84b2be65a53403bc167d81eacf5712e3155c6d0dbbb101b1025bba5628b3de:12

value
2310647
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b92233ad88f29d06da32f7512d97b328679dae56 OP_EQUALVERIFY OP_CHECKSIG
address
1HstysopK8TfKcArFGAqCNqiEHM78icTb1
transaction
de84b2be65a53403bc167d81eacf5712e3155c6d0dbbb101b1025bba5628b3de
spent
true